Default Maniacs make me mad

Villain (BB) is a borderline maniac. He's got a bet size tell where I know he's weak on the flop, on the turn that's either a real hand or a bluff or semibluff because I look weak. My problem is I'm not sure if I'm ahead on the turn. I can't call the turn bet unless I'm sometimes ahead unimproved. But if I fold the river every time, that was wrong, so... [img]/images/graemlins/confused.gif[/img]

No Limit Hold'em Ring Game (6 max) , 6 players
Blinds : $1/$2

Stacks:
UTG : $288.30
MP : $204.30
CO : $419.19
Button : $152.02
Hero : $203.15
BB : $282.72

Pre-flop: (6 players) Hero is SB with T[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] K[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img]
2 folds, CO limps, Button limps, Hero limps, BB checks.

Flop: 6[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] 2[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 9[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] ($8, 4 players)
Hero checks, BB checks, CO checks, <font color="#cc0000">Button bets $2</font>, Hero calls, <font color="#cc0000">BB raises to $4</font>, CO calls ($4), Button calls ($2), Hero calls ($2).

Turn: T[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] ($24, 4 players)
Hero checks, <font color="#cc0000">BB bets $20</font>, CO folds, Button folds, Hero calls.

River: J[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] ($64, 2 players)
Hero checks, <font color="#cc0000">BB bets $25</font>, Hero calls.

Flop you have 2nd Nut flush draw+2 overcards, Turn you Have Tp2ndK, 2nd nut flush draw, +overcard, should be willing to push on either one of these streets and get your money in the middle.

As played, call river and expect to be ahead here against your maniac enough to make this profitable.

It's interesting though certainly high variance. If you miss the river you have to check-call a big bet. I dunno, I don't think I like it. If he has a hand big enough to pay off, then we need to improve and that doesn't happen often enough. As long as I check to him he could be betting with pure air, but as soon as I make him call he plays a lot better.

Hmmm.. something bothers me about this.

If I CR the turn and he calls, I'm behind and my equity stinks because there's only one card left. If I CR the turn and he folds, I was ahead already and dont need fold equity, though I guess it gives me some defence against random junk improving on the river.
